Road cycling around Saumane offers routes through the diverse terrain of the Cévennes, characterized by deep valleys, forested hills, and winding river systems. The area features numerous climbs and descents, providing a challenging yet rewarding experience for road cyclists. Many routes follow quiet roads that connect small villages, showcasing the region's natural beauty and rural character.

This small sacred monument, too, is a symbol of remembrance of the crucifixion and resurrection of Jesus Christ. However, its design is very unique and unlike the usual crosses that often crown mountain peaks. At the end of the triangular base plate, a small wall appears to have been built, its sides terminating in the shape of a stepped gable. In the center is a V-shaped cutout, the ends of which extend significantly beyond the height of the small wall. From this V emerges the longitudinal beam of the cross, which, however, has two crossbeams. This double crossbeam, as well as the lack of a corpus, is typical of the so-called "Lorraine Cross."

Frequently Asked Questions

How many road cycling routes are available around Saumane?

There are over 80 road cycling routes around Saumane, catering to various skill levels from easy to difficult. The komoot community has highly rated these routes, with an average score of 4.5 stars.

Are there easy road cycling routes suitable for beginners in Saumane?

Yes, Saumane offers a few easy road cycling routes. One option is the Château de Saint-Jean-du-Gard loop from L'Estréchure, a 23.4 km path with a manageable elevation gain, ideal for those new to road cycling in the Cévennes.

What are some challenging road cycling routes with significant elevation gain near Saumane?

For experienced cyclists seeking a challenge, the region offers routes with substantial climbs. The Route des Aigladines – Abarines Bridge loop from Saumane is a difficult 61.9 km route featuring over 1300 meters of elevation gain, providing a demanding ride through the Cévennes landscape.

Are there circular road cycling routes around Saumane?

Many of the road cycling routes around Saumane are designed as loops, allowing you to start and finish in the same location. Examples include the Col du Mercou (570 m) – Bridge over the Salindrenque loop from Saumane and the Roadbike loop from L'Estréchure - Maison ronde en bois dans les Cévennes.

What is the best season for road cycling in Saumane?

The Cévennes region around Saumane is generally pleasant for road cycling from spring through autumn. Spring offers lush greenery and moderate temperatures, while autumn provides vibrant foliage. Summers can be warm, so early morning or late afternoon rides are often preferred during peak season.

Are there any scenic road cycling routes that pass through villages or offer good views?

Absolutely. The routes in Saumane often connect small villages and offer picturesque views of the Cévennes. The Le Pompidou Village – Saint-André-de-Valborgne loop from Saumane, for instance, leads through valleys and charming settlements. Many routes also pass by highlights like Saint-Jean-du-Gard.

What kind of terrain can I expect on road cycling routes in Saumane?

Road cycling around Saumane is characterized by the diverse terrain of the Cévennes, featuring deep valleys, forested hills, and winding river systems. You can expect numerous climbs and descents on quiet roads that connect small villages, showcasing the region's natural beauty and rural character.

Are there any notable mountain passes or viewpoints accessible by road bike near Saumane?

Yes, the area is known for its mountain passes. Cyclists can explore passes such as Col de Saint-Pierre, Asclier Pass, and Exile Pass. These often provide panoramic views of the Cévennes landscape.

What do other road cyclists enjoy most about road cycling in Saumane?

The area is high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 4.5 stars from over 130 reviews. Reviewers often praise the challenging yet rewarding experience, the quiet roads connecting small villages, and the stunning natural beauty of the Cévennes.

Are there any attractions or points of interest along the road cycling routes?

Many routes offer opportunities to see local attractions. For example, the Château de Saint-Jean-du-Gard loop passes near the historic village of Saint-Jean-du-Gard. Other highlights in the region include The 4000 Steps and various scenic viewpoints like the Beautiful view of the Cévennes.

How long do road cycling routes typically take to complete in Saumane?

Route durations vary significantly based on distance and elevation. For instance, a moderate route like the Roadbike loop from L'Estréchure - Maison ronde en bois dans les Cévennes (27.8 km) typically takes around 1 hour 34 minutes, while longer, more challenging routes can take over 3 hours.
